Spectroscopic Assignment of the FIR Laser Emissions Observed in Dimethyl Ether (CH3OCH3) and Methyl Fluoroform (CH3CF3)

By using the spectroscopic constants recently reported, it has been possible to assign many FIR transitions in dimethyl ether ( CH3OCH3) and methyl fluoroform (CH3CF3) that have been previously published in the scientific literature. Several of these assigned transitions have high quantum numbers and they can be used to improve the accuracy of the spectroscopic constants.
